6. User rights

To enforce your rights, please use the details provided in the Contact section. In doing so, please ensure that an unambiguous identification of your person is possible.

Right to information and access
You have the right to obtain confirmation from us about whether or not your personal data is being processed, and, if this is the case, access to your personal data.

Right to correction and deletion
You have the right to obtain the rectification of inaccurate personal data. As far as statutory requirements are fulfilled, you have the right to obtain the completion or deletion of your data.
This does not apply to data which is necessary for billing or accounting purposes or which is subject to a statutory retention period. If access to such data is not required, however, its processing is restricted (see the following).

Restriction of processing
As far as statutory requirements are fulfilled you have the right to demand for restriction of the processing of your data.

Data portability
As far as statutory requirements are fulfilled you may request to receive data that you have provided to us in a structured, commonly used and machine-readable format or – if technically feasible –that we transfer those data to a third party.

Object to direct marketing
Additionally, you may object to the processing of your personal data for direct marketing purposes at any time. Please take into account that due to the organizational reasons, there might be an overlap between your objection and the use of your data within the scope of a campaign that is already running.

Objection to data processing based on the legal basis of “legitimate interest”
In addition, you have the right to object to the processing of your personal data at anytime, insofar as this is based on legitimate interest. We will then terminate the processing of your data unless we demonstrate compelling legitimate grounds according to legal requirements which override your rights.

Withdrawal of your consent
In case you consented to the processing of your data, you have the right to revoke this consent at any time with effect for the future. The lawfulness of data processing prior to your withdrawal remains unchanged.
